Peruvian Torch Information

Trichocereus peruvianus, otherwise known as Peruvian Torch Cactus, is a fast growing columnar cactus that is one of San Pedro’s cousins. It is native to the high elevations of Peru, specifically in the Andes mountains. Their skin can range from dark green to a beautiful blue hue. They are prized for their gorgeous long, yellow spines. They can also achieve great thickness, which is another reason why Peruvian Torches are highly sought after in the cactus community. In similar fashion to it’s cousins Pachanoi, Bridgesii, and Scopulicola, Pervianus product large white, night-blooming flowers that have a lovely fragrance.

Coyote Information

Coyote has become a relatively popular Peruvian Torch named cultivar within the Trichocereus community. It originates from an old growth stand that’s over 30 years old in East County San Diego. Many old growth pieces were taken from the stand (with permission from the owner) by a Tricho cultivator and were distributed across the community far and wide. The original owner of the old growth Coyote stand says they got it from a grower in Alpine, CA. Coyote is characterized by its beautiful blue-green hue. Once established it grows quickly and very thick, like most other Peruvian Torches. Something interesting about Coyote is that its spines are on the shorter side compared to other Peruvianus cultivars.
